A young man killed, a fatal fall… The remaining mysteries in the saga that fascinates America

From our correspondent in the United States,

Money, power, and for a long time, impunity. After three generations of prosecutors ruling the region, this South Carolina dynasty is now synonymous with infamy. That of Alex Murdaugh, sentenced Friday to life imprisonment for the double murder of his wife and son. But if this verdict – pending a possible appeal – puts an end to a mystery that has held America in suspense for two years, the legal saga is far from over. Investigations into two other suspicious deaths, in 2015 and 2018, have resumed. They are discussed in the Netflix documentary, Murdaugh Murders: A Southern Scandal.

2015: A youth found dead on a country road

Stephen Smith was 19 years old. In a still very conservative South, he was proudly and openly gay. On July 8, 2015, his body was found in the middle of the road on a deserted country road, in the middle of the night, the back of his skull sunken. The coroner concludes that the young man, who seems to have broken down, was knocked down, and that he could have been hit by the rear view mirror of a vehicle. But this thesis is questioned by the coroner, who is investigating the circumstances – and not the cause – of death. According to the report obtained by the local channel WISTV, the first officer who intervenes saw “no sign suggesting that the victim was struck by a vehicle”: no debris or brake marks; and Stephen still has his shoes, though unlaced, on his feet.

Officers are questioning his relatives and friends. In the report, one name appears several times: that of Alex Murdaugh’s eldest son, Buster, a former classmate of the victim. In the Netflix documentary, several young people mention the rumor of a secret homosexual relationship, which has, at this stage, not been corroborated. But for some unclear reason, Buster is never heard from by investigators. Nothing very surprising when you know that until 2005, the patriarch of the family, Randolph Murdaugh was, like his father and his grandfather, the chief prosecutor of the region.

The investigation is finally closed, with a death resulting from a “hit and run” (death after a hit and run). But two weeks after the double murder of Maggie and Paul Murdaugh, South Carolina authorities announced on June 22, 2021 that they were reopening the investigation into the death of Stephen Smith. They say they have obtained new information while investigating the double murder. Last January, the investigators say they have made “progress”, without giving details. 2018: Fatal Fall of the Domestic Worker

Gloria Satterfield was more than a governess who worked for the Murdaughs for 20 years. Paul’s ex-girlfriend introduces her as the second mother of the youngest in the family. On February 2, 2018, Maggie Murdaugh called for help. She tells them that Gloria Satterfield fell backwards down some brick stairs and is bleeding profusely. Alex Murdaugh then told authorities that his half-conscious employee managed to talk to him before help arrived and told him that the dogs had tripped him. But in the Netflix documentary, the family gardener disputes this version: according to him, Alex Murdaugh was not there before help arrived.

Gloria Satterfield dies two weeks later. Without anyone knowing why, his death was not reported to a medical examiner, and no autopsy was performed. Alex Murdaugh then assures the Satterfield family that he compensates them through his liability insurance. He gets $4 million… which he keeps for himself.

The ex-girlfriend of Paul Murdaugh claims that the employee had found, shortly before his fall, a bag of pills belonging to Alex Murdaugh, who suffers from an addiction to opiates which he hides from his family. And this commercial insurance, thanks to which he receives a jackpot? He took it out a month before the tragedy.

Alex Murdoch doesn’t know it yet, but this insurance fraud marks the beginning of his downfall. Gloria Satterfield’s relatives are suing him and his law firm partners realize he has been embezzling millions of dollars for years. Under this threat – and that of the prosecution of his son Paul, responsible for the death of a friend in a boating accident he was driving drunk – Alex Murdoch kills his wife and son on June 7, 2021. According to prosecutors, for to attract sympathy and gain time in the face of a tightening noose.

The SLED is opening an investigation into the death of Gloria Satterfield in September 2021. Last year, her relatives gave their consent for her remains to be exhumed. One of their lawyers told the New York Post on Friday that the exhumation should take place soon.

2021: Failed Suicide Staged

Three months after the double murder, while authorities still have no suspects, Alex Murdaugh calls the police after being shot in the head while changing a tire. His story of an unknown assailant collapses: he confesses to having tried to organize his suicide by paying his dealer, so that his son Buster receives 10 million dollars in life insurance.

Serious doubts remain about this version. Curtis Edward Smith, a very distant cousin, claims that Alex Murdaugh asked him to come and brandished a gun. According to Smith, the two men would have struggled and a shot would have gone off, injuring the lawyer. In total, Murdaugh wrote his dealer 437 checks for $2.4 million over 8 years to buy oxycodone pills, which he swallowed by the handful, up to 60 a day. The last check, for $22,109, dates from ten days before the murders of his wife and son.

The sequel: more trials to come

Sentenced to two life sentences without the possibility of release, Alex Murdaugh should appeal, his lawyers said. They believe that he could not benefit from a fair trial in the face of the media circus, in particular with the Netflix documentary launched a week before the verdict.

Removed from the bar, the lawyer still has to answer for 99 charges, mainly of financial and insurance fraud. He also faces several civil actions, in particular for the fatal boat accident.

“Even if he was sentenced to life, the authorities will continue their investigations into any other homicide of which Murdaugh could be the author”, estimates the lawyer Duncan Levin, who notably represented Harvey Weinstein and Clare Bronfman. “Even without additional time in prison, justice must be done, it is always a priority for law enforcement. »

The main dates of the case

July 8, 2015. Stephen Smith, 19, is found dead on a country road, killed with a blow to the head. He was a classmate of Alex Murdaugh’s eldest son, Buster. Relatives evoke in the Netflix documentary rumors of a possible secret homosexual affair, which have not been corroborated at this stage.

February 26, 2018. The Murdaughs’ housekeeper, Gloria Satterfield, died two weeks after falling down the stairs of “Moselle”, their property. His death was never reported to a medical examiner, and no autopsy was performed. The ex-girlfriend of younger brother Paul Murdaugh claims the employee found a bag of pills belonging to Alex Murdaugh shortly before he fell.

February 24, 2019. Mallory Beach, 19, dies in the crash of the drunken boat Paul Murdaugh.

June 7, 2021. Maggie and Paul Murdaugh are shot dead.

June 22, 2021. Authorities are reopening the investigation into the death of Stephen Smith, based on new information obtained in the investigation into the double murder of Paul and Maggie Murdaugh.

September 4, 2021. Alex Murdaugh calls the police after being shot in the head. He has since admitted to having asked an acquaintance to kill him so that his eldest son, Buster, could receive $10 million in life insurance. But his accomplice obviously missed it.

March 3, 2023. Murdaugh is found guilty of the double murder of his wife and son and sentenced to life.
